Adenylate Cyclase 4 (ADCY4)

Adenylate cyclase type 4 is a member of the family of adenylate cyclases, which are membrane-associated enzymes that catalyze the formation of the secondary messenger cyclic adenosine monophosphate (cAMP). Mouse studies show that adenylate cyclase 4, along with adenylate cyclases 2 and 3, is expressed in olfactory cilia, suggesting that several different adenylate cyclases may couple to olfactory receptors and that there may be multiple receptor-mediated mechanisms for the generation of cAMP signals.  The deduced protein contains 1,077 amino acids. Semiquantitative RT-PCR detected ubiquitous expression of ADCY at moderate levels.
